Technical Specifications

Series Excalibur™
Package Tube
Part Status Obsolete
Amplifier Type J-FET
Number of Circuits 1
Output Type -
Slew Rate 3.4V/µs
Gain Bandwidth Product 2 MHz
-3db Bandwidth -
Current - Input Bias 4 pA
Voltage - Input Offset 500 µV
Current - Supply 290µA
Current - Output / Channel 80 mA
Voltage - Supply, Single/Dual (±) 7V ~ 36V, ±3.5V ~ 18V
Operating Temperature -40°C ~ 85°C
Mounting Type Surface Mount
Package / Case 8-SOIC (0.154", 3.90mm Width)
Supplier Device Package 8-SOIC
